The Xilinx XC3190A-1C/PQ160 is a Field-Programmable Gate Array (FPGA) from the XC3000 series. This particular model is housed in a 160-pin Plastic Quad Flat Pack (PQFP) package, offering a balance of size and pin count. The XC3000 series is known for providing a flexible and cost-effective solution for implementing custom digital circuits.
Applications
- Prototyping digital systems: Allows engineers to rapidly prototype and test digital designs before committing to fixed silicon.
- Custom logic implementation: Used to implement specific logic functions tailored to unique application requirements.
- Glue logic: Can be configured to act as glue logic, connecting different components within a system.
- Digital signal processing (DSP): Capable of performing various DSP tasks with appropriate configuration.
- Embedded systems: Often employed in embedded systems requiring programmable logic.
Features
- Configurable Logic Blocks (CLBs): Contains an array of CLBs that can be interconnected to implement complex logic functions.
- Input/Output Blocks (IOBs): Provides programmable I/O pins for interfacing with external devices.
- Programmable Interconnect: Features a flexible interconnect matrix that allows CLBs and IOBs to be connected in a variety of ways.
- Static RAM (SRAM) Configuration: Configured using static RAM, allowing for fast reprogramming.
- On-Chip Oscillators: Includes on-chip oscillators for timing and clock generation.
- Low Power Consumption: Designed for relatively low power consumption, suitable for various applications.
Benefits
- Flexibility: Offers unparalleled flexibility in implementing custom digital circuits.
- Reprogrammability: Can be reprogrammed multiple times, allowing for design iterations and updates.
- Time-to-Market: Reduces time-to-market by enabling rapid prototyping and implementation.
- Cost-Effectiveness: Provides a cost-effective solution for low- to medium-volume production runs.
- Design Security: Offers a degree of design security as the configuration is stored in SRAM.
Additional Details
The XC3190A-1C/PQ160 operates with a specific voltage level (typically 5V). Detailed timing characteristics and configuration data are available in the Xilinx documentation for the XC3000 series. The '1C' designation typically refers to the speed grade or temperature range. The device is configured via a configuration file loaded into the on-chip SRAM. The PQ160 package offers a good compromise between pin density and ease of soldering.